Understanding Ligament Injuries

Ligaments are tough, fibrous tissues that connect bones and stabilize joints. When overstretched or torn due to sudden movement, trauma, or sports injuries, they can lead to pain, swelling, and instability in the joint.

Common Types of Ligament Injuries:
  • Knee Ligament Injury (ACL / PCL / MCL Tear)

  • Ankle Ligament Sprain

  • Shoulder Ligament Tear

  • Wrist and Elbow Ligament Strain

Early diagnosis and proper rehabilitation are key to preventing long-term joint instability and weakness. This is where physiotherapy for ligament injury plays a vital role.

Why Physiotherapy is Crucial for Ligament Injury Recovery

Physiotherapy helps restore joint function, improve strength, and promote tissue healing naturally — without depending heavily on medications or surgery.

1. Pain and Swelling Management

Using techniques like ice therapy, electrotherapy, and ultrasound therapy, inflammation and pain are reduced in the early phase.

2. Regaining Joint Mobility

Once swelling subsides, gentle mobilization exercises and stretching help restore the joint’s range of motion.

3. Muscle Strengthening

Strengthening the muscles surrounding the injured ligament ensures joint stability and prevents re-injury.

4. Balance and Proprioception Training

For ankle and knee injuries, our physiotherapists use balance boards and neuromuscular re-education exercises to retrain your coordination and joint control.

Home Care Tips After a Ligament Injury

While professional physiotherapy is essential, following these simple tips at home can support faster recovery:

  • Follow the R.I.C.E. method — Rest, Ice, Compression, Elevation

  • Avoid putting weight on the injured joint too early

  • Perform prescribed exercises regularly

  • Wear supportive braces if recommended by your physiotherapist

  • Stay consistent with therapy sessions
